INDIA’S FIRST PM MITRA PARK
CONTEXT & SIGNIFICANCE
- On September 17, 2025, Prime Minister Narendra Modi laid the foundation stone of the first Pradhan Mantri Mega Integrated Textile Region and Apparel (PM MITRA) Park in Dhar district, Madhya Pradesh.
- The launch coincided with the PM’s 75th birthday and marks his second birthday visit to Madhya Pradesh after 2022.
- This event also witnessed the launch of two major social initiatives:
- ‘Swasth Nari Sashakt Parivar’ – a women’s health campaign
- ‘Rashtriya Poshan Maah’ (8th Edition) – a national nutrition initiative
- The PM MITRA Park initiative is a step toward boosting India’s textile manufacturing capabilities, creating sustainable livelihoods, and promoting Make in India and Atmanirbhar Bharat
ABOUT PM MITRA SCHEME
- Full Form: Pradhan Mantri Mega Integrated Textile Region and Apparel
- Launched by: Ministry of Textiles, Govt. of India (2021)
- Objective: To integrate the entire textile value chain (fibre → fabric → fashion) in one location
- Number of Parks: 7
- States Selected:
- Madhya Pradesh (Dhar)
- Telangana
- Gujarat
- Karnataka
- Uttar Pradesh
- Maharashtra
- Tamil Nadu
FEATURES OF THE DHAR MITRA PARK
Parameter | Details |
Location | Bhainsola village, Dhar district, MP |
Land Area | Approx. 2,158 acres |
Facilities Planned | · 20 MLD Common Effluent Treatment Plant
· 10 MVA Solar Power Plant · 81 Plug-and-Play Units · Modern Road & Utility Infrastructure · Continuous Water & Electricity Supply · Housing for Workers & Social Amenities for Women |
Key Beneficiaries | · Cotton farmers, textile manufacturers, local workforce, women employees |
Investment Proposals Received : | · ₹ 23,146 crore |
The park aims to become a self-sustained industrial township, offering not just factories but livable, worker-friendly infrastructure.
ECONOMIC & STRATEGIC IMPORTANCE
- Boost to Cotton Economy: Enhances value addition for local cotton producers
- Employment: Generates direct and indirect jobs across the value chain
- Export Competitiveness: Reduces logistics and manufacturing costs
- Green Industry: Incorporates solar power and effluent treatment for sustainability
- Plug-and-Play Model: Attracts MSMEs and large-scale textile companies
- Integrated Development: Encourages urbanisation around industrial clusters
SOCIAL CAMPAIGNS LAUNCHED ALONGSIDE
Swasth Nari Sashakt Parivar Campaign
- Focus: Women’s health and well-being
- Duration: Till October 2, 2025
- Delivered through: Ayushman Arogya Mandirs
- Core Themes:
- Mental health awareness
- Gender equity in healthcare
- Adolescent anaemia & PCOS screening
- Encouraging active lifestyle and self-care
“Men must extend support, and women should dedicate at least an hour daily to self-care without guilt.” – Dr Saloni Sidana, NHM Director
RASHTRIYA POSHAN MAAH
- Focus Areas:
- Reduced sugar and oil intake
- Early Childhood Care and Education (ECCE)
- Promotion of local, nutritious food resources
- Objective: Behavioural change in dietary habits and strengthening community-based nutrition awareness
